Klappentext Let Psychologies Magazine show you the path to a calmer, happier lifeReal Calm is your guide to getting rid of stress for good. The unrelenting demands of everyday life never stop, and stress is a natural byproduct of modern life; you cannot change that, but you can change your response. Psychologies Magazine, the leading magazine for intelligent people, explores stress, calm and the spectrum in between to show you how to cope. Packed with tips, ideas and expert insight, this book draws on cutting edge global research to help you understand your brain's response to stress and build real calm into your everyday life. What does life look like when you're calm? What are the obstacles standing in your way? How is stress affecting you right now? Let the experts guide you to the answers you need, and start living better today.Everyone knows that stress is bad for your health, relationships, productivity and quality of life -- but how can we avoid it? The answer is we can't -- we can only temper our response, use the stress as a tool or make it go away. This book shows you how, with clear, helpful advice and a real-world focus on the little things that have a great impact on your day-to-day.* Explore what real calm means to you* Learn what's standing between you and your peace of mind* Identify your stressors and develop a self-care plan* Deal with the big things, and let the little things goMotivational, inspirational and highly practical, Real Calm is your roadmap to a happier, healthier, calmer you.
